01:49I will give you the opportunity to actually answer some questions, unlike she did, and I will allow you to explain exactly what the policies in New York are as it relates to cooperation between the state and federal agents.
02:09First of all, glad you're not running against me. Thank you.
02:16Secondly, I appreciate the opportunity to break through all the noise here today and to stop the talking points that keep mischaracterizing our policies in the great state of New York.
02:29New York is not a sanctuary or a haven for criminals.
02:32We devote an enormous amount of our energy working to keep New Yorkers safe, $2.5 billion I've allocated just in the last few years.
02:40We do cooperate with ICE when it comes to investigating or building a case against criminals.
02:46We do this all the time.
02:49And when someone goes through the criminal justice system in the state of New York, they do their time in prison,
02:55we alert ICE as to when 30 days in advance of when they're to be removed, and we send them away.
03:01That's how it's supposed to work.
03:03But what we do not do under our laws is divert our essential resources to protect everyday New Yorkers from crimes themselves
03:11and have that help ICE with civil immigration enforcement.
03:15That is their job.
03:17That is the federal government's job.
03:19And we cannot be told to enforce federal laws.
03:23It's not constitutional.
03:24Or to use all of your limited resources to spend all that time doing their job.

03:41I'm sorry to interrupt you because I actually, in my district office down in lower Manhattan,
03:46witnessed ICE officers waiting for immigrants to come out of a courtroom.
03:52These are immigrants who have asylum applications.
03:57And I'm sure you agree with me that asylum is a lawful pathway to immigrate to this country.
04:03Is that correct?
04:04That is absolutely correct.
04:05So in order to make these immigrants here unlawfully,
04:11the DHS is now dismissing their cases,
04:15their own removal proceedings against them to void out the asylum claim.
04:20That way, when they go downstairs in the elevator,
04:24there are ICE agents that can be there.
04:26And to arrest them and put them in expedited removal.
04:29And they don't have an asylum claim that is live anymore
04:33because they've just voided it out.
04:36These are non-criminal, these are non-violent immigrants
04:40who are here going through lawful process.
04:44And this is who the Trump administration is going after every single day.
